Be the direct contact for key stakeholders to communicate the value proposition; be the main executor of the infield brand strategy. Develop customer relationships whilst maximising opportunities based on strong account plans.

Customer selling and relationship management:

  • Drive Sales – Own the customer engagement for target HCPs across channels, to reflect customer preferences, leveraging available content and multiple engagement channels.
  • Develop SMART pre-call objectives in line with territory plans and aligned to brand strategy.
  • Effectively handle objections or concerns.
  • Consistently gain a logical, reasonable call to action/close on every sales call.
  • Educate medical providers, other relevant decision makers and affiliated healthcare professionals.
  • Identify & develop disease state experts building advocacy aligned to territory plan.

Continuously strive to gain market intelligence:

  • Organise and manage stakeholder meetings.
  • Differentiates AbbVie's value proposition to physicians or other stakeholders assigned from any competitors.
  • Strong communication skills, ability to flex style based on customer insights.

Clinical and Market Knowledge Development:

  • Deep understanding of the product and its place within the local NHS healthcare economy.
  • Ability to navigate NHS ecosystem barriers & identify opportunities to deliver collaborative results.
  • Share best practice to enhance our business success.
  • Proactively initiate, develop and implement a growth plan to develop in current position and prepare for future opportunities.
  • Demonstrate in-depth disease, product, market and competitive intelligence expertise.
  • Have a deep understanding of the multi-stakeholder environment.

Territory Management:

  • Continuously analyse sales reports (CRM etc.) and overlay field intelligence to adapt the territory plan.
  • Collaborate closely with medical colleagues to support customer needs and implement regional/national programs.
  • Develop a business plan for own territory in line with brand strategy.
  • Effectively target and track resources to maximise sales opportunities.
  • Adhere to industry and AbbVie compliance requirements.

Qualifications:

  • Must have proven Pharmaceutical sales success.
  • Excellent customer relationship skills to build, develop and maintain internal and external partnerships.
  • Solutions focused, positive attitude is a must.
  • Strategic mindset, data analytics proficiency.
  • Excellent team player.
  • Experience within Immunology and/or specialty secondary care would be advantageous, but not essential.

Behaviours:

  • Possess excellent customer engagement skills to build, develop, and maintain internal and external partnerships.
  • Capable of engaging both remotely and in-person.
  • A solution-focused approach, resilience, and a positive attitude.
  • Curiosity and self-awareness are essential.
  • A passion for experimentation to identify new opportunities for growth and improvement.
  • Commitment to achieve goals, even when faced with obstacles or setbacks, a strong work ethic.

How to prepare for a job interview at Allergan

Know Your Product Inside Out

Make sure you have a deep understanding of the product and its role within the NHS healthcare economy. Be prepared to discuss how it differentiates from competitors and how it can benefit healthcare professionals. This knowledge will help you communicate the value proposition effectively.

Master the Art of Relationship Building

Since this role involves developing customer relationships, think about examples from your past experiences where you've successfully built rapport with stakeholders. Be ready to share these stories during the interview to demonstrate your excellent customer engagement skills.

Prepare SMART Objectives

Before the interview, develop some S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) objectives that align with the territory plans. This shows that you’re strategic and can set clear goals, which is crucial for driving sales and managing accounts effectively.

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ills

Be prepared to discuss how you've handled objections or concerns in previous roles. Think of specific instances where you turned a challenge into an opportunity. This will highlight your solution-focused approach and resilience, both of which are key behaviours for this position.
